California Natural Resource Agency Announces Public Meetings on Safeguarding California from Climate Change
Sacramento, CA...The California Natural Resource Agency, along with other state agencies, will be drafting the new Safeguarding California Plan (Plan), an update to the 2009 climate adaptation strategy, and announced a series of public meetings to gather public input on key issues and approaches that stakeholders feel should be addressed in the update.
The meetings will be held in Sacramento, Klamath, Los Angeles, Merced, and Truckee. Full details on the meetings is below
